CLI Auth with API Token

Hello, is it possible to authenticate via API token using Confluence CLI? How can I do this? So far, I have been receiving an error message stating that the password field cannot be empty.

Yes, You can authenticate confluence CLI using a Token. Pass the CLI action as below.

--user "xxxx" --token "xxxx" --action getSpaceList
